Lewis Carroll enjoyed a sudden rise in acclaim with the publication of Alice’s Adventures in Wonderland. Readers across the world enjoyed the eccentric and whimsical qualities of his work. Carroll was also a successful mathematician, and while his narratives and poetry may seem absurd, there is usually a veiled logic to them. This is especially true in The Hunting of the Snark. First published in 1876, it is usually classified as a nonsense poem. The stanzas and lines describe incomprehensible imagery and detail, but in structured syllables and rhyme schemes. It remains a favorite among Carroll’s works.
